Illinois's continental climate presents significant challenges for single-ply roofing membranes. The frigid winters bring heavy snow loads and freeze-thaw cycles that can stress roofing materials and lead to ice dams, while the hot, humid summers can cause expansion and contraction, potentially leading to leaks if not properly installed. Strong winds are also a concern throughout the year. Ensuring your single-ply membrane is robust and expertly installed is critical to safeguarding your home against these demanding seasonal shifts.
When considering single-ply roofing in Illinois, selecting materials that can withstand both extreme cold and heat is important. The 25% rule generally applies to roof repairs, suggesting that if more than 25% of a roof deck needs replacement due to damage, it might be more cost-effective to replace the entire roof. This is a common guideline to help homeowners understand when repairs might escalate into a larger project, impacting the overall cost.

While there isn't a universally 'cheapest' month for roofing across all climates, shoulder seasons like spring or fall can sometimes offer better pricing due to lower demand. However, in Illinois, prioritizing timely repairs to prevent damage from harsh winters or summer storms is often more important than trying to time the market for cost savings.
